Output 58f9a31437e8a5844eef32561379c82a9bd2530dd22c85766eab20a5c8b59661: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e86319e7d2e46a4af05468195183d3c42be5a68 OP_EQUAL
address
35w1mKRAp4ZmMD5FovF65PabrDBQgD8X9S
transaction
58f9a31437e8a5844eef32561379c82a9bd2530dd22c85766eab20a5c8b59661
spent
true